|
@ -44,6 +44,7 @@ import com.yxt.common.core.vo.PagerVo; |
|
|
import org.springframework.beans.factory.annotation.Autowired; |
|
|
import org.springframework.beans.factory.annotation.Autowired; |
|
|
import org.springframework.stereotype.Service; |
|
|
import org.springframework.stereotype.Service; |
|
|
|
|
|
|
|
|
|
|
|
import java.math.BigDecimal; |
|
|
import java.util.ArrayList; |
|
|
import java.util.ArrayList; |
|
|
import java.util.Collections; |
|
|
import java.util.Collections; |
|
|
import java.util.List; |
|
|
import java.util.List; |
|
@ -237,9 +238,10 @@ public class InvoicedService { |
|
|
BusDeliveredApply busDeliveredApply = busDeliveredApplyFeign.fetchBySid(query.getSid()).getData(); |
|
|
BusDeliveredApply busDeliveredApply = busDeliveredApplyFeign.fetchBySid(query.getSid()).getData(); |
|
|
List<BusDeliveredApplyDetails> busDeliveredApplyDetails = busDeliveredApplyDetailsFeign.selectByApplySid(query.getSid()).getData(); |
|
|
List<BusDeliveredApplyDetails> busDeliveredApplyDetails = busDeliveredApplyDetailsFeign.selectByApplySid(query.getSid()).getData(); |
|
|
if (data != null) { |
|
|
if (data != null) { |
|
|
|
|
|
billApplicationIInfoVo.setModelSid(busDeliveredApply.getModelSid()); |
|
|
|
|
|
billApplicationIInfoVo.setModelName(busDeliveredApply.getModelName()); |
|
|
billApplicationIInfoVo.setSid(data.getSid()); |
|
|
billApplicationIInfoVo.setSid(data.getSid()); |
|
|
billApplicationIInfoVo.setProcInsId(data.getProcInstSid()); |
|
|
billApplicationIInfoVo.setProcInsId(data.getProcInstSid()); |
|
|
billApplicationIInfoVo.setInvoiceTotal(data.getTotalBillMoney()); |
|
|
|
|
|
billApplicationIInfoVo.setOrgPath(data.getOrgSidPath()); |
|
|
billApplicationIInfoVo.setOrgPath(data.getOrgSidPath()); |
|
|
billApplicationIInfoVo.setSaleType(data.getSaleTypeValue()); |
|
|
billApplicationIInfoVo.setSaleType(data.getSaleTypeValue()); |
|
|
billApplicationIInfoVo.setSellerDept(data.getSaleDeptName()); |
|
|
billApplicationIInfoVo.setSellerDept(data.getSaleDeptName()); |
|
@ -328,6 +330,9 @@ public class InvoicedService { |
|
|
registerContractImages.add(cldjhtApplicationAppendx.getFileUrl()); |
|
|
registerContractImages.add(cldjhtApplicationAppendx.getFileUrl()); |
|
|
} |
|
|
} |
|
|
} |
|
|
} |
|
|
|
|
|
if (StringUtils.isNotBlank(data.getOneBillMoney())){ |
|
|
|
|
|
billApplicationIInfoVo.setInvoiceTotal(new BigDecimal(data.getOneBillMoney()).multiply(new BigDecimal(busBillVehicleVos.size())).toString()); |
|
|
|
|
|
} |
|
|
billApplicationIInfoVo.setCarBuyContractImages(appCarBuyContractImages); |
|
|
billApplicationIInfoVo.setCarBuyContractImages(appCarBuyContractImages); |
|
|
billApplicationIInfoVo.setCustomerInvoiceApplyImages(customerInvoiceApplyImages); |
|
|
billApplicationIInfoVo.setCustomerInvoiceApplyImages(customerInvoiceApplyImages); |
|
|
billApplicationIInfoVo.setInvoiceApplyConfirmImages(invoiceApplyConfirmImages); |
|
|
billApplicationIInfoVo.setInvoiceApplyConfirmImages(invoiceApplyConfirmImages); |
|
@ -341,6 +346,8 @@ public class InvoicedService { |
|
|
billApplicationIInfoVo.setIsCanEdit(true); |
|
|
billApplicationIInfoVo.setIsCanEdit(true); |
|
|
} |
|
|
} |
|
|
}else { |
|
|
}else { |
|
|
|
|
|
billApplicationIInfoVo.setModelSid(busDeliveredApply.getModelSid()); |
|
|
|
|
|
billApplicationIInfoVo.setModelName(busDeliveredApply.getModelName()); |
|
|
billApplicationIInfoVo.setProcInsId(busDeliveredApply.getProcInstId()); |
|
|
billApplicationIInfoVo.setProcInsId(busDeliveredApply.getProcInstId()); |
|
|
billApplicationIInfoVo.setOrgPath(busDeliveredApply.getOrgSidPath()); |
|
|
billApplicationIInfoVo.setOrgPath(busDeliveredApply.getOrgSidPath()); |
|
|
billApplicationIInfoVo.setSaleType(busDeliveredApply.getPaymentMethodKey()); |
|
|
billApplicationIInfoVo.setSaleType(busDeliveredApply.getPaymentMethodKey()); |
|
|